Matsuzaka to have MRI on ailing shoulder

May 29, 2008 - 4:12 AM SEATTLE (Ticker) -- Boston Red Sox righthander Daisuke Matsuzaka will accompany the team to Baltimore on Wednesday night before traveling on to Boston to undergo tests on his ailing shoulder.

Matsuzaka was lifted from a start in the fifth inning on Tuesday with what the team termed "shoulder fatigue."

He will visit with team doctors and undergo an MRI in Boston.

The Red Sox have not said that Matsuzaka will miss a start, although the club has listed TBA as the probable pitcher for Monday's game, which would be the Japanese hurler's turn in the rotation.

Should he not be able to take his turn, Boston could activate Clay Buchholz from the disabled list or recall Justin Masterson for his third career start.
